Processing details
■Controls
• For a Multiple CPU system configuration, the bit device specified with (D1) of the target CPU (n1) turns ON or OFF with the
bit operation of (n2).
If reading a bit device of the target CPU, use the M(P).DDRD/D(P).DDRD instructions. Refer to the following
for details on the M(P).DDRD/D(P).DDRD instructions.
MELSEC iQ-R Programming Manual (Instructions, Standard Functions/Function Blocks)
